Blackened Cajun seasoning is a spice blend used in Cajun cuisine. Typically cooked in a very hot cast iron skillet creating a crispy- crusty texture with a characteristic dark blackened exterior and tender- juicy inside, with a complex flavor
on meats, poultry, or seafood.
Blackened Cajun seasoning is typically less Spicer than other Cajun seasonings.
Ingredients:
Onion, Garlic, Thyme, Paprika, Cayenne, Red Chili Pepper, Black Pepper, Fennel, Lemon Peel, Oregano, White Pepper, Citric Acid, Silicon Dioxide(1% or less)
Suggested Uses:
Add oil in a heated heavy black iron skillet, heat over med high heat until smoking. Dip the meat or fish in melted butter, coat generously with ‘Blackened seasoning’, cook both side in the skillet until it has attractive dark crispy crust with tender & juicy inside. Serve with rice or seasonal vegetables.
